California Investing $2.9 Billion To Double Number Of EV Chargers

The government of California has approved a $2.9 billion investment plant to accelerate the state’s electric vehicle charging and hydrogen refueling targets for 2025. According to the plan approved by the California Energy Commission (CEC) on December 14, the investment…

Electric Vehicle Charging Stations Global Market Report 2022

The global electric vehicle charging stations market is expected to grow from $4.03 billion in 2021 to $5.40 billion in 2022 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 34.1%. The market is expected to reach $17.85 billion in 2026…
